Events are so visual and if something can be gorgeous, then it should be. Life's too short for bland and boring. One person I think really demonstrates this is Amy Atlas. Amy, based in New York, is recognised for creating the stylized dessert bar trend and has appeared across a variety of American TV shows, press, and has a fantastic blog, Sweet Designs. Designs such as Amy's continually inspire me and remind me why I love doing what I do.
